Communications:
MATH 117 was not submitted to satisfy the symbolic systems sequence because it hasn't been enforced as a prerequisite for the current requirement. The Mathematics Department recommends that MATH 107 satisfy the sequence. Several departments have submitted the stats courses that use MATH 117 in the sequence. The Mathematics Department will submit 117 for the symbolic systems subcommittee to consider.

Sociology 202: Social Statistics
this is a statistics course and its link to a recognizable group or individual is lacking; the syllabus and form did not articulate the learning goals and criteria well. While data are the focus, it is a course designed for students to learn statistics and not their application to problems in sociology.
MGMT 101: Intro to Entertainment Business
lacks social science content; poorly articulated theory and/or data analysis; syllabus does not indicate use of theory; pre-professional
SW 100: Introduction to Social Welfare
form does not articulate the social science criteria. It is a pre-professional course lacking theory or data component, thus does not meet learning goal 2 or 3.
IS 100: Introduction to Business
lacks a theory/data component; what is the group/individual being studied? Not a social science course.
JOURN 100: Introduction to Mass Communication
focus is historical, not social science; weak in data/theory
